I know that 65-80% of the stomach is removed with VSG, but as you heal the stomach becomes capable of holding more contents.
When does this stop?
I am shy of 3 months out, and I am capable of eating 5 ounces of food (more than half a cup!) and feeling some comfortable restriction. I then stop. I feel like I shouldn't be done healing, and there is likely room for more expansion.
I am already at a point where I've actually lost and gained weight.
I hear more often than not that significant stretching is a myth. I never take my meals to an extreme degree, or have had vomiting from over eating. I try to avoid testing restriction.
I am fearful that if I am capable of eating 5 ounces in a sitting now at a mere 84 days post surgery that this can only increase.
I feel like every week I can eat more and more, and I don't like it. I want it to stop.
